Feature Requests Settings API for account level configuration

Under Review

Summary

Introduce an API to read and manage account-level settings, similar to the existing Checks and Webhooks APIs.

Context

We manage multiple client accounts and already provision checks and webhooks fully via the API. However, account-level settings must still be configured manually through the dashboard.

When onboarding a new client, we currently have to:

  • Open an existing account’s settings
  • Open a second tab
  • Log out and log in to the new account
  • Manually replicate all settings to ensure consistency

This process is repetitive and prone to human error.

Requested Scope

Access via API to manage:

Account settings

  • Account name
  • Time zone

Company details

  • VAT identification number
  • Name
  • Company
  • Address
  • Billing email

Notification & feature toggles

  • Weekly report
  • Favicon fetcher
  • White label
  • IP filtering interest
  • Apdex alerts
  • SSL expiration notifications
  • SSL renewal notifications
  • Domain expiration notifications

Why This Matters

For agencies and companies managing multiple accounts, this would allow full automation of onboarding and ensure consistent monitoring standards across all clients.

Even if these settings rarely change, they are crucial during initial provisioning and standardization.

JCID
Created on February 15, 2026 · Last update on February 16, 2026
1 Comment
Adrien Rey-Jarthon
Changed status to Under Review
Like   Feb 16, 2026 08:54